Short description
Dorsal soft rays (total): 13; Anal spines: 0; Anal soft rays: 8. Body depth slightly more than head length; mouth narrow and subterminal; 2 pairs barbels, longer than orbit; eye-diameter 5 to 6.5 times in head; dorsal spine strong and serrated, the denticles strong and recurved; scales small, transverse scale-rows 11/9, circumferential scales 40-44; tubercles on snout and cheeks of females smaller than those of males (Ref. 4832).
Biology
    Glossary (e.g. epibenthic)
Inhabits large rivers with rocky bottoms, clear and fast water and little or no vegetation. Made into fish paste.
